Etiquette and Espionage by Gail Carriger
Kategori: Historical fiction

Sophronia has always liked to dismantle things, wanting to know how things work. Being a nuisance to her family, her mother jumps at the opportunity of her going to finishing school -- and not destroying her older sister Petunias coming-out ball.
What her mother doesn't know is that this finishing school puts the emphasis on the finishing part, being a school for female spies in-training. Not only learning how to properly curtsy and how to do the quadrille, they also learn how to portion out poison so that only half of ones guests die. This first year should be very interesting!

This series, being set about fifty years befor the story arc about Alexia Tarabotti, is a mix of proper etiquette, silliness and tie-ins to the first series. Many a thing about the world of Alexia becomes clear after reading this. So, go read, do!
